General Information about Prednisolone

Lastly, prednisolone can also be used for treating varied pores and skin circumstances, similar to psoriasis. Psoriasis is a persistent skin disease characterised by pink, itchy, and scaly patches on the pores and skin. Prednisolone helps to cut back the inflammation and suppress the immune response, offering relief from the signs of psoriasis.

Furthermore, prednisolone is used for treating intestinal problems, such as ulcerative colitis. This inflammatory bowel disease causes irritation and ulcers within the digestive tract, leading to belly pain, diarrhea, and rectal bleeding. Prednisolone helps to minimize back this irritation, providing aid from the symptoms of ulcerative colitis.

In some circumstances, prednisolone may be used as a part of most cancers remedy. It is often prescribed to help handle the unwanted effects of chemotherapy, corresponding to nausea, vomiting, and lack of urge for food. Prednisolone can also be used to deal with certain forms of leukemia, a type of cancer that impacts the blood and bone marrow.

Endocrine problems, corresponding to adrenocortical insufficiency, can also be treated with prednisolone. This situation occurs when the adrenal glands do not produce sufficient hormones, causing fatigue, muscle weak point, and weight loss. Prednisolone helps to replace these hormones and handle the symptoms of adrenocortical insufficiency.

Prednisolone can additionally be used for the remedy of certain blood disorders, similar to aplastic anemia and hemolytic anemia. These situations happen when the physique does not produce enough pink blood cells, resulting in fatigue, weak spot, and increased threat of infections. Prednisolone helps to increase the production of pink blood cells, thus bettering the symptoms of these blood problems.

One of the primary makes use of of prednisolone is for the treatment of allergy symptoms. Allergies happen when the physique overreacts to a substance, such as pollen, mud mites, or pet dander. This can result in signs corresponding to sneezing, itching, and watery eyes. Prednisolone works by decreasing the physique's immune response, thus offering aid from these symptoms. It is usually prescribed in circumstances where different allergy medications haven't been effective.

In addition to allergic reactions, prednisolone can additionally be generally used for treating arthritis. Arthritis is a condition that causes irritation within the joints, resulting in ache, stiffness, and decreased mobility. Prednisolone works by reducing this irritation, providing aid to those who suffer from arthritis. It can additionally be used in combination with different medicines, such as nonsteroidal anti-inflammatory medication (NSAIDs), to handle the symptoms of arthritis.

Collagen diseases, corresponding to lupus, may additionally be effectively managed with the usage of prednisolone. Lupus is an autoimmune illness in which the physique's immune system attacks its own tissues and organs. Prednisolone helps to suppress the overactive immune response, providing relief from inflammation and ache. It is commonly prescribed in combination with other medicines to handle the symptoms of lupus.

Another condition that might be effectively treated with prednisolone is respiratory issues, such as bronchial asthma. Asthma is a persistent lung illness that causes difficulty in respiratory, coughing, and wheezing. Prednisolone helps to lower the irritation within the airways, making it easier for people with bronchial asthma to breathe. It is usually prescribed as a short-term remedy throughout bronchial asthma assaults, or as a maintenance treatment for individuals who've frequent asthma symptoms.

Prednisolone is also used within the treatment of sure eye illnesses, such as keratitis. This situation is characterized by inflammation of the cornea, which might lead to imaginative and prescient problems. Prednisolone is usually prescribed in the type of eye drops to reduce irritation and promote healing of the cornea. It may also be used to deal with other eye circumstances, such as uveitis and conjunctivitis.

Prednisolone is a generally used treatment that belongs to the group of medicine generally recognized as corticosteroids. It is a synthetic form of the hormone cortisol, which is of course produced by the body's adrenal glands. This powerful medicine has quite a lot of medical uses, including treating allergies, arthritis, breathing problems, certain blood problems, collagen ailments, eye ailments, most cancers, endocrine problems, intestinal problems, swelling because of certain situations, and pores and skin conditions.
